How's it four against one? Isn't it three against one? Zod, Non, and Ursa?

It's still the whole speed thing for me with the Flash, Kryptonians, Gladiator, Silver Surfer, etc. They could complete so many devastating attacks, while someone with speed like the Hulk is still trying to figure out what just hit him 500 times before he even threw a punch, (granted Flash's 500 punches wouldn't have the effect of the Kryptonian's, Gladiator's or the Surfer's. Or, they could burn a hole through his whole chest and out his back before he could even move to stop them. He couldn't lay a finger on them, and they could finish him. I know that the Hulk has super speed to some degree. He can run 200 miles an hour, but even that is like stop motion compared to the speed of the Kryptonians and the others mentioned above. If they were written consistently, and properly, there is almost no battle they wouldn't come out on top of, barring a fight with one of the Celestials, and some of the top tier heavy hitters who can mess with reality. The problem with that is no one wants to read about a fight that ends in a few seconds, so they totally ignore the speed factor so often, like Flash slipping on marbles dropped on the floor. This is so annoying, as he could literally run between every marble with ease, or even vibrate through them. How do you take someone by surprise that can move at 10 times the speed of light? Answer...you couldn't.
